Nursing Home Case Mix Data Collection Entering Second Stage

The streamlined approach that the Department of Health (DOH) is using to gather data to adjust nursing home January 2020 Medicaid rates for acuity is occurring as scheduled. After the 10-day period during which providers had the opportunity to submit additional or corrected MDS information to the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), DOH will be downloading the updated federal file and using it to update the MDS data reflected on the Health Commerce System (HCS). The Dear Administrator Letter (DAL) that lays out the schedule is available here, and the slides used by DOH to outline the new process are here.

Providers will have two weeks starting July 3rd to verify that the appropriate MDS is being matched to each resident and to contact DOH to request corrections if discrepancies are identified. While the process should minimize the number of instances where DOH staff intervention is required, providers should reach out to DOH for Assessment Reference Date (ARD) changes, to add or remove a resident after matching is completed, or to make changes to a finalized file. For assistance, please contact MDSBRHCR@health.ny.gov. Please be sure to use secure transfer if sending any resident-identifying information. Instructions for using the secure transfer function of the HCS are provided on page 22 of the webinar slides.

We remind members that this new process has no impact on how the case mix index (CMI) is calculated or on the MDS assessments that are used for the calculation. It simply provides a more efficient way for DOH to compile, and for providers to verify, the data that is customarily used for calculating CMI.

We urge members to carefully review their data for accuracy and to let us know if they encounter any difficulties with the process. Providers should complete the matching process and finalize their data by July 17th. The required certification is due by July 24th.
